N-chloromethyl-brucine   Click here for help

GtoPdb Ligand ID: 344

Abbreviated name: CMB
Synonyms: N-chloromethylbrucine
Compound class: Synthetic organic
Comment: N-chloromethyl-brucine is a synthetic brucine analogue.
